El código postal 95206 cubre Stockton, California, con una población de unos 67,501 y un ingreso medio del hogar de $79,751.

Dónde está 95206

Stockton, California — el área que la Oficina del Censo delimita para este código postal. Los códigos postales son conjuntos de rutas de reparto y no áreas, así que esto es la aproximación del Censo, no un límite del Servicio Postal.
